Shout From The Rooftops

by Donald Mehl  
4/14/2012 / Devotionals


As our days slip away, it becomes increasingly urgent for all to know that the time is coming, perhaps sooner rather than later, when each member of the human race will kneel before Almighty God and must declare Jesus Christ as Lord over all. Are you ready for that day?

For redeemed Bible believers who have met Him at the foot of the cross and know Him personally as Savior and Master of their life, that face-to-face meeting will be one of unimaginable joy, praise and thanksgiving.

But, for those who had ignored Him, or for those who had only paid lip service to Him, that upcoming, inevitable meeting will strike bone-chilling fear in their heart when they realize who they had rejected. Yes, even they will finally kneel before the King of Kings and Lord of Lords, but sadly, it will be too late for them. I have many friends and family who are among those who do not yet know Him as the Savior and the Lord of their life. My prayers go out for them.

In recent years, the Lord has given me a burden of passion for shouting the saving gospel from the rooftops while there is still time. I know that the Lord has called me to share His Word in a very special way to many who are searching for His Truth...but have been unable to find it because they are looking in the wrong places, or, perhaps they are not looking at all.

I am so thankful that from the very moment we reach out to God in forgiveness and repentance...humbly acknowledging that Jesus is Lord...and deliberately inviting Him into our life, then, He will reside within us forever. In other words, the moment we reach out by faith alone to receive His gift of salvation, we have the promises from Scripture that He is ours, and we are His...no matter what!

Scripture promises that at the moment of our salvation...
* The Holy Spirit is sealed within us the instant we become a born again child of God.
* Then, as sons and daughters of the most-high God, we become heirs to His kingdom forever.
* He will never leave us or forsake us.
* Although we will often stray like sheep, He will find us and gently lead us back to Him.
* The penalty for all of our past, present, and future sins and shortcomings will have been paid in full by Jesus' sacrifice on the cross...never more to be remembered.

"Dear Lord, I'm so thankful for Your promises because I often stumble in my daily walk with You. I confess there are many mornings when my waking thoughts are not on You in praise and thanksgiving. Hours will go by, and yes, even days might pass by when I don't set aside quiet time as a priority to be fed through Your written Word, or pour out my heart in prayer to You. Many are the times when my thoughts, words, or actions are not pleasing or honoring to You. Oh Lord, forgive me for my shortcomings that result from being pre-occupied with the busyness of life. I love You, I have no friend like You, and I long to follow in Your footsteps as You lead the way. Help me to keep my eyes on You above all else. Take my hand, Precious Lord, and hold on tight...for You are my all in all. Thank You, Jesus...in Your Name I pray. Amen!"

Revelation 22:17 KJV
And the Spirit and the bride say, Come. And let him that heareth say, Come. And let him that is athirst come. And whosoever will, let him take the water of life freely.

In that final plea from Scripture, God compassionately declares, "Your spiritual thirst is crying out, 'I want to be satisfied.' Believe in Me; come to Me and drink freely of the Living Water. Whosoever will...please come!"

He is patiently waiting to hear from you. Choose to drink of His life-giving Water today!

Praise God for His promises! I am only a sinner saved by grace...and am humbled and so thankful to be a child of the King. You, too, can be a heaven-bound son or daughter of the most-high God for all of eternity...just as He has promised!

However, the choice is yours...and the time left for choosing might be shorter than you think.
